Westcon COO given new president role
David Grant's appointment comes four months after distie adds collaboration and cybersecurity arms to business

Westcon International has announced the internal promotion of David Grant to President, four months after a business-wide restructure of operational units. Grant (pictured) is currently serving as COO of the $3bn-revenue VAD, and will continue in that role in addition to being president. The latest management change at Westcon comes four months after the New York-headquartered distributor rejigged its EMEA operations and made a series of senior appointments.
